Llechrydau
Llechrydau is a hamlet in Llansilin, Powys, Wales. Llechrydau is situated nearby to the locality Tyn-y-rhyd Wood, as well as near the hamlet Bedwlwyn.Places of Interest

Llwynmawr
Village
Photo: Peter Craine,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Llwynmawr is a village in the Ceiriog Valley in North Wales, about halfway between the villages of Glyn Ceiriog and Pontfadog, in the community of Glyntraian. The name means "big grove". Llwynmawr is situated 2 miles north of Llechrydau.

Pandy
Village
Pandy is a hamlet in the Ceiriog Valley, Wrexham County Borough, Wales. It is located on the confluence of the River Ceiriog to the east, and the smaller River Teirw flowing from Nantyr moors to the north-west. Pandy is situated 2 miles northwest of Llechrydau.
